The Function of a Medical Assistant

medical assistant with Blanchester OH nursing home patientThe duties of a medical assistant can be varied as well as demanding. Essentially their job is to make sure that the Blanchester OH clinics, hospitals and other healthcare institutions where they work operate successfully. Based on the type or size of facility, they may be more of a clinical assistant, an administrative assistant, or in smaller practices both. They are tasked with giving direct support to the nurses, doctors and other medical practitioners but can also be found working in an office or at the front desk. Some of the possible responsibilities of a medical assistant include:

  • Completing insurance forms and filing claims
  • Scheduling and confirming appointments
  • Taking vital signs and weighing patients
  • Taking blood and other tissue and fluid samples
  • Preparing rooms and instruments for physicians
  • Providing general support during exams and procedures

Even though medical assistants can carry out almost any duty they are qualified to under Ohio law, some elect to specialize in a particular area and earn certification. Two of the choices offered are for the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) and the Certified Medical Administrative Assistant (CMAA) offered by the National Healthcareer Association (NHA).

Medical Assistant Programs

Unlike most other healthcare practitioners, medical assistants are not mandated to become licensed, certified, or to obtain a college degree. However, a number of Blanchester OH health care employers choose to hire graduates of an accredited medical assistant training program (more on accreditation later ) that are certified. There are basically 2 options available for a formal education. The first and quickest way to becoming a medical assistant is to acquire a certificate or diploma. These programs generally take about a year to finish, some as little as six to nine months. They are developed to teach the fundamentals of medical assisting and prepare graduates for entry level positions. The second alternative is to obtain an Associate Degree, which are typically two year programs available at junior and community colleges together with trade and vocational schools. They are more extensive in nature than the diploma or certificate programs, and include liberal arts courses in addition to the medical assistant classes. They frequently have a clinical element requiring an internship with a local medical practice. Associate Degrees are often a pre-requisite for and credits can be transferred to a four year Bachelor’s Degree in Medical Assistant Studies or a similar field.

Certification Options for Medical Assistants

As previously mentioned, certification is not a legal requirement, but is an excellent option for individuals who want to boost their careers. Not only will it help in attaining a job after graduation, but it may also help with preliminary salary negotiations. A number of potential Blanchester OH medical employers just will not employ a medical assistant that has not attained certification or accredited formal training. Among the most popular and arguably the most highly regarded certification is the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) offered by the American Association of Medical Assistants (AAMA). To qualify to sit for the CMA examination, a candidate must be a graduate or will be graduating within thirty days from an accredited medical assistant program. Alternative certifications are available also, for instance the CMAA and the CCMA that we discussed earlier which are provided by the NHA.

Is the Medical Assistant College Accredited? There are many great reasons to ensure that the college you enroll in is accredited. To start with, accreditation helps guarantee that the instruction you receive will be both extensive and of the highest quality. Second, if you plan on becoming certified, you must complete an accredited program. Two of the acknowledged organizations for accreditation are the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P) and the Accrediting Bureau of Health Education Schools (ABHES). If your school is not accredited by either of these agencies, you will not be allowed to take the CMA exam. Also, if you intend on obtaining a student loan or financial assistance, they are often not offered for non-accredited programs. And finally, as previously mentioned, many prospective Blanchester OH employers will not employ a medical assistant who has not graduated from an accredited school.

What is the School’s Passing Percentage? Most of the accredited medical assistant schools design their programs to prepare students to pass one or more certification examinations. First, you must find out which of the certifications the programs you are looking at are preparing their students to take. If you are interested in taking the CMA for instance, then obviously you will want to choose a program focused on that certification. Second, learn what the program’s passage rate is for the certification and contrast it to the national average. This is one of the ways to help assess the quality of a school’s program. Obviously programs with low rates are ones that you will want to eliminate.

Blanchester, Ohio

Blanchester is a village in Clinton and Warren counties in the U.S. state of Ohio. The population was 4,243 at the 2010 census. Blanchester is part of the Wilmington, Ohio Micropolitan Statistical Area, which is also included in the Cincinnati-Wilmington-Maysville, OH-KY-IN Combined Statistical Area.

According to the United States Census Bureau, the village has a total area of 4.25 square miles (11.01 km2), of which 4.15 square miles (10.75 km2) is land and 0.10 square miles (0.26 km2) is water.[1]

As of the census[3] of 2010, there were 4,243 people, 1,636 households, and 1,113 families residing in the village. The population density was 1,022.4 inhabitants per square mile (394.8/km2). There were 1,854 housing units at an average density of 446.7 per square mile (172.5/km2). The racial makeup of the village was 97.8% White, 0.4% African American, 0.3% Native American, 0.3% Asian, and 1.1%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 0.4% of the population.
